The #1 question I get daily is, “Where do you get all of your coupons?”

-Sunday Newspapers ( I buy between 2-4 inserts a week from my hometown and order 2-4 inserts from Houston) The reason I have a friend send me coupons from her area is because all regions vary when it comes to coupons. Unfortunately, I have compared inserts over time and my area gets twice as less coupons as Houston, Tx! Hopefully you have a dear friend that will do the same for you!

 

-All You Magazine- is an excellent resource for coupons. I just received my issue in the mail today and it had $56.76 worth of coupons in this ONE issue!

 

-In stores - You can always find coupons in your local stores. You name a store, they will have coupon laying around SOMEWHERE! Cosmetic counters, stuck on the products(peelies), machines that spit out coupons(blinkies), tables with displayed items, and in the store ads.

 

-Mail- All of that mail that you normally throw out thinking there is nothing in there, STOP! Look for coupons first! Also, there are several ways to sign up for coupons for your favorite products that can be mailed to you.

 

-Product websites- A lot of times, you can go to your favorite product’s websites and they will most likely have a coupon for an item! If not, click on the contact me section of their website and shoot them an email. It can’t hurt asking for coupons. Make sure you tell them how much you  love their product! I have received many great coupons this way. 3/10 times I receive coupons for FREE products! Who doesn’t love a free item!

 

Facebook- This is the biggest social media website out there! It was only a matter of time that mfgs started using this to promote products. As a matter of fact, this is probably where I receive most of my coupons for FREE products! There are tons of giveaways and coupons daily! I try to update you the best I can when I see something new! Like the products’ pages and you will be updated with their statuses on your newsfeed! If you do not have a facebook account, I highly recommend you getting one!

 

Free Samples-This might be a surprise to you, but sometimes the best way to get GREAT coupons is through filling out information to receive a free sample. Most of the time the company will include a few high value coupons in with your sample!

Inside packaging- WAIT before you throw that package of lunch meat out! I buy Land O’ Frost lunch meat and there is always a coupon inside the package! A few other examples are Reynold’s wrap has coupons under the lid made out of cardboard and the Banquet frozen meals sometimes have coupons inside the packaging! Just look for those little dotted lines before you throw anything away ;)

Newsletters- When you sign up for monthly or weekly newsletters, sometimes they will include surprise coupons in those emails! These are a great way to save on your favorite products!
eCoupons – Cellfire is a great source for mobile coupons! Check your area and make sure this is offered for your stores! I, unfortunately, do not get to take advantage of this! If you have a grocery store that has cards to load coupons on, take advantage of this!! These are store coupons that can be matched with MFG coupons!

 

What in the world do you do with all of those coupons now?

 

I will give you my method, but different methods will work for different people! I keep a binder full of all my coupons! I would suggest finding a binder with an expandable file folder in the front to keep your store ads, coupon policies, store lists, and your paperclipped coupons that you are using that day! I would also recommend a zipper pouch either attached to your binder or a three-ring pouch so you can have your pens, markers, and scissors with you at all times! I promise you will use all three!! You need to buy trading card holders. These are found at your major stores like Walmart and Target for around $5 dollars a pack for 30 sheets! I would go ahead and buy 2 packs! You will use them, trust me! They are usually located in the front by the trading cards. Don’t waste your time going to the school supplies, because they are probably not there! Look by the registers! You also need dividers. I would suggest buying the dividers with the writable tabs because the dividers that have the tabs with the slip in paper tend to fall out with all the tossing around! Okay, you are ready to start putting your binder together!! Here are a list of my categories: (You may need to adjust these categories a bit that works best for your family)

 

I have Main Categories(Bold) and Sub-categories:

 

Baby/Kids
-Diapers/Wipes
-Formula
Grocery
-Baking
-Beverages
-Breakfast
-Canned/Jar Items
-Condiments
-Dairy
-Instant Dinners
-Meat/Refridgerated
-Pasta/Breads
-Snacks
Household
-Air Fresheners
-Cleaning supplies
-Food Storage
-Laundry
-Miscellaneous
-Office supplies
-Paper Products
-Pets
Medicines
-Cold/Cough/Flu
-First Aid
-Pain Relief
-Sinus/Allergy
-Stomach
-Vitamins/diet
Personal Care
-Cosmetics
-Deodorants
-Eye Care
-Feminine
-Hair products
-Lotions
-Oral Care
-Soaps
